Job Description
The role is an Assistant Vice President position at State Street Taipei Branch. The primary responsibility is to support country Senior Management to design the framework, implement the controls, assist Business Units to execute tasks requested by external regulators and internal stakeholders. Acting as a single contact to coordinate legal entity wide projects and capable to perform variety of types of assignments timely .
Key Responsibilities
Business Contingency Plan (BCP)
1. The role involves participating as a country representative of the local business units in regional or global working groups as required
2. Responsibilities include developing and maintaining country contingency plans and policy, conducting branch employee mapping in Global system, and coordinating branch-wide BCP exercises.
Control Oversight
1. Ensure effective internal controls are in place to mitigate operational risks.
2. Perform annual branch-wide controls review in system.
3. Serve as a country representative to respond control related requests.
Policy/ Procedure Development and Compliance
1.Draft and enforce policies and procedures in alignment with regulatory and corporate standards.
2.Ensure adherence to regulatory and internal policies, minimize operational, legal, and reputational risks, and reinforce ethical standards.
3.Work closely with legal, risk, compliance and audit teams.
Risk Assessment and Incident Response Coordination
1.Work with second line partners to perform annual Risk Control Self-Assessment (RCSA) and Legal Entity Risk Assessment (LERA).
2.Assist Business Units to come up with remediations to incidents and facilitate processing in Global system.
Stakeholder Collaboration
1. Lead and/or coordinate across appropriate business units implementation of activities in relation to regulatory, governance and first line of defense initiatives and projects, such as but not limited to anti-money laundering (AML), know your customer (KYC), outsourcing, operational resiliency, privacy, regulatory reporting review, treating client fairly, and conflict of interest.
2. Support Country Head on legal entity wide projects, exercises, and audits.
3. Back up to act as head of administration overseeing office operations, facilities management, procurement, general administrative functions.
Legal Entity Governance
1. Ensure adherence to governance frameworks, ethical standards, and regulatory requirements.
2. Manage legal entity management committee (LEMC) meetings, prepare minutes, maintain statutory records, and regulatory filings.
Flexibility & Adaptability
1. The role requires adaptability to changing responsibilities, management shifts, and corporate strategies.
2. Ability to take on ad-hoc assignments as needed.
Skills & Considerations
1. Minimum of ten years of experience in risk control related functions within financial institutions. Experienced in Project Management would be a plus.
2. Ability to work in an international environment.
3. Able to face off to senior executives.
4. Strong interpersonal skills for cross-department communication.
5. Proficiency in MS PowerPoint and Excel, with strong attention to details.
6. Language proficiency in Mandarin and English.
